{"id":40112,"date":"2023-04-21T12:43:22","date_gmt":"2023-04-21T17:43:22","guid":{"rendered":"https:\/\/www.bjultrasonic.com\/diy-frequency-generator\/"},"modified":"2025-01-21T00:17:28","modified_gmt":"2025-01-21T05:17:28","slug":"diy-frequency-generator","status":"publish","type":"post","link":"https:\/\/www.bjultrasonic.com\/fr\/diy-frequency-generator\/","title":{"rendered":"G\u00e9n\u00e9rateur de fr\u00e9quences DIY : guide complet et facile"},"content":{"rendered":"<p>G\u00e9n\u00e9rer des fr\u00e9quences sonores ou radio \u00e0 la maison peut sembler complexe, mais avec les bons composants et un peu de savoir-faire, la cr\u00e9ation d&rsquo;un g\u00e9n\u00e9rateur de fr\u00e9quence DIY est tout \u00e0 fait r\u00e9alisable.  Ce processus, bien que potentiellement simple pour des fr\u00e9quences basses, n\u00e9cessite une attention particuli\u00e8re pour des fr\u00e9quences plus \u00e9lev\u00e9es, notamment dans le domaine des ultrasons. Cet article explore les diff\u00e9rentes approches pour construire un g\u00e9n\u00e9rateur de fr\u00e9quence DIY, en soulignant les d\u00e9fis et les solutions possibles.<\/p>\n<h3>Choix du Microcontr\u00f4leur<\/h3>\n<p>Le c\u0153ur de votre g\u00e9n\u00e9rateur de fr\u00e9quence DIY sera un microcontr\u00f4leur.  Des options comme l&rsquo;Arduino Uno ou Nano sont populaires en raison de leur facilit\u00e9 d&rsquo;utilisation et de leur large communaut\u00e9 de support.  Cependant, pour des applications n\u00e9cessitant une g\u00e9n\u00e9ration de fr\u00e9quence pr\u00e9cise \u00e0 haute fr\u00e9quence, un microcontr\u00f4leur plus puissant avec un convertisseur num\u00e9rique-analogique (DAC) \u00e0 haute r\u00e9solution sera n\u00e9cessaire. La fr\u00e9quence d&rsquo;\u00e9chantillonnage du DAC limite la fr\u00e9quence maximale productible.<\/p>\n<table class=\"table table-striped table-bordered\">\n<thead>\n<tr>\n<th>Microcontr\u00f4leur<\/th>\n<th>Fr\u00e9quence d&rsquo;horloge (MHz)<\/th>\n<th>R\u00e9solution DAC<\/th>\n<th>Fr\u00e9quence maximale approximative (Hz)<\/th>\n<th>Commentaires<\/th>\n<\/tr>\n<\/thead>\n<tbody>\n<tr>\n<td>Arduino Uno<\/td>\n<td>16<\/td>\n<td>10 bits<\/td>\n<td>Environ 10 kHz (avec limitations)<\/td>\n<td>Adapt\u00e9 aux basses fr\u00e9quences<\/td>\n<\/tr>\n<tr>\n<td>ESP32<\/td>\n<td>240<\/td>\n<td>12 bits<\/td>\n<td>Significativement plus \u00e9lev\u00e9e<\/td>\n<td>Meilleur pour fr\u00e9quences plus \u00e9lev\u00e9es<\/td>\n<\/tr>\n<tr>\n<td>STM32 (certaines variantes)<\/td>\n<td>Variable (jusqu&rsquo;\u00e0 200+ MHz)<\/td>\n<td>12 ou 16 bits<\/td>\n<td>Tr\u00e8s \u00e9lev\u00e9e<\/td>\n<td>N\u00e9cessite une programmation plus avanc\u00e9e<\/td>\n<\/tr>\n<\/tbody>\n<\/table>\n<h3>G\u00e9n\u00e9ration de la Forme d&rsquo;Onde<\/h3>\n<p>Une fois le microcontr\u00f4leur choisi, il faut d\u00e9terminer la forme d&rsquo;onde souhait\u00e9e.  Les formes d&rsquo;onde les plus courantes sont sinuso\u00efdale, carr\u00e9e, triangulaire et en dents de scie.  La g\u00e9n\u00e9ration de ces formes d&rsquo;ondes peut se faire via des librairies d\u00e9di\u00e9es disponibles pour la plupart des microcontr\u00f4leurs.  Pour des formes d&rsquo;onde complexes, une approche plus sophistiqu\u00e9e, impliquant la manipulation directe des registres du DAC, pourrait \u00eatre n\u00e9cessaire.<\/p>\n<h3>Amplification du Signal<\/h3>\n<p>Le signal g\u00e9n\u00e9r\u00e9 par le microcontr\u00f4leur aura g\u00e9n\u00e9ralement une amplitude faible.  Pour des applications n\u00e9cessitant une puissance plus importante, un amplificateur op\u00e9rationnel (op-amp) sera n\u00e9cessaire. Le choix de l&rsquo;op-amp d\u00e9pendra de l&rsquo;amplitude et de la fr\u00e9quence du signal.  Pour les fr\u00e9quences ultra-sonores, une attention particuli\u00e8re doit \u00eatre port\u00e9e \u00e0 la bande passante de l&rsquo;amplificateur.<\/p>\n<h3>G\u00e9n\u00e9ration de Fr\u00e9quences Ultrasonores<\/h3>\n<p>La g\u00e9n\u00e9ration de fr\u00e9quences ultrasonores (au-dessus de 20 kHz) pr\u00e9sente des d\u00e9fis suppl\u00e9mentaires.  La pr\u00e9cision de la fr\u00e9quence et la stabilit\u00e9 du signal sont cruciales.  Des cristaux de quartz de haute pr\u00e9cision peuvent \u00eatre utilis\u00e9s pour assurer une fr\u00e9quence stable.  Pour les applications exigeant des fr\u00e9quences tr\u00e8s \u00e9lev\u00e9es ou une puissance importante, l&rsquo;utilisation de transducteurs pi\u00e9zo\u00e9lectriques sp\u00e9cifiques, comme ceux fournis par des entreprises sp\u00e9cialis\u00e9es (dans certains cas, les produits de Beijing Ultrasonic peuvent \u00eatre pertinents), est indispensable.  La conception du circuit devra prendre en compte les caract\u00e9ristiques \u00e9lectriques des transducteurs.<\/p>\n<h3>Logiciel et Programmation<\/h3>\n<p>Le logiciel est essentiel pour contr\u00f4ler la fr\u00e9quence et la forme d&rsquo;onde.  L&rsquo;utilisation d&rsquo;un environnement de d\u00e9veloppement int\u00e9gr\u00e9 (IDE) comme l&rsquo;Arduino IDE ou des environnements plus avanc\u00e9s pour les microcontr\u00f4leurs plus puissants est n\u00e9cessaire.  Le code devra g\u00e9rer la g\u00e9n\u00e9ration du signal num\u00e9rique, sa conversion analogique et le contr\u00f4le de l&rsquo;amplificateur (le cas \u00e9ch\u00e9ant).<\/p>\n<p>La cr\u00e9ation d&rsquo;un g\u00e9n\u00e9rateur de fr\u00e9quence DIY est un projet stimulant qui offre une grande flexibilit\u00e9. En suivant ces \u00e9tapes et en choisissant les composants appropri\u00e9s, il est possible de construire un g\u00e9n\u00e9rateur fonctionnel adapt\u00e9 \u00e0 diverses applications, allant des exp\u00e9riences simples aux projets plus complexes impliquant des fr\u00e9quences ultrasonores.  Cependant, il est important de prendre les pr\u00e9cautions n\u00e9cessaires pour la s\u00e9curit\u00e9, surtout lorsqu&rsquo;on travaille avec des fr\u00e9quences \u00e9lev\u00e9es.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>G\u00e9n\u00e9rer des fr\u00e9quences sonores ou radio \u00e0 la maison peut sembler complexe, mais avec les bons composants et un peu de savoir-faire, la cr\u00e9ation d&rsquo;un g\u00e9n\u00e9rateur de fr\u00e9quence DIY est tout \u00e0 fait r\u00e9alisable. Ce processus, bien que potentiellement simple pour des fr\u00e9quences basses, n\u00e9cessite une attention particuli\u00e8re pour des fr\u00e9quences plus \u00e9lev\u00e9es, notamment dans<\/p>\n","protected":false},"author":1,"featured_media":19348,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[6411],"tags":[],"class_list":["post-40112","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-blog","prodpage-classic"],"aioseo_notices":[],"_links":{"self":[{"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/posts\/40112","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/comments?post=40112"}],"version-history":[{"count":0,"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/posts\/40112\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/media\/19348"}],"wp:attachment":[{"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/media?parent=40112"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/categories?post=40112"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.bjultrasonic.com\/fr\/wp-json\/wp\/v2\/tags?post=40112"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}